The Advantages of Using Wooden Pallets1. Strength and Durability
Wooden pallets are renowned for their exceptional strength, making them appropriate for transporting heavy loads. Constructed from difficult or softwoods, these pallets can endure the rigors of transport, stacking, and handling.
Table 1: Strength Comparison of Different Pallet Materials
Material TypeLoad Capacity (lbs)Typical UsesWooden Pallets1,500 - 4,000Heavy items, machineryPlastic Pallets1,000 - 3,000Food, pharmaceuticalsMetal Pallets2,000 - 5,000Industrial and outside usage2. Cost-Effectiveness
Wooden pallets are usually cheaper than their plastic or metal equivalents. They are readily offered and can be recycled several times, making them a cost-effective alternative for organizations.
3. Eco-Friendly Option
As the world progressively concentrates on sustainability, wooden pallets shine with their eco-friendliness. Sourced from renewable resources, wooden pallets are eco-friendly and can be recycled into other wood items once they reach the end of their useful life.
4. Personalization
Wooden pallets can be quickly tailored to meet specific measurements and tolerances. This versatility improves their use for various items and applications in different markets.
5. Quickly Repairable
Among the most significant advantages of wooden pallets is their reparability. Harmed pallets can often be fixed utilizing easy tools, minimizing waste and preserving expense performance for organizations.
Types of Wooden Pallets
There are 2 main types of wooden pallets used in shipping:
1. Block PalletsDescription: These pallets include blocks for boosted stability and strength.Advantages: They can be lifted from all four sides, making them versatile for numerous forklifts and pallet jacks.2. Stringer PalletsDescription: Stringer pallets are made up of boards or stringers that supply assistance by linking the top and bottom decks.Benefits: They are often lighter and more economical, but less robust compared to block pallets.Table 2: Comparison of Block and Stringer PalletsFeatureBlock PalletsStringer PalletsLifting DirectionAll four sides2 sides justWeightHeavier (more durable)Lighter (more economical)RepairabilityModerateEasierApplicationsHeavy loads/industrial usageGeneral utilizeBest Practices for Shipping with Wooden Pallets1. Frequently asked question SectionQ1: Are wooden pallets safe for food transportation?
A1: Yes, Wooden Pallets For Sale pallets can be safe for food transportation. However, it's important to utilize heat-treated pallets that decrease the danger of contamination and abide by food security standards.
Q2: How many times can a wooden pallet be reused?
A2: The lifespan of a wooden pallet can vary from 5 to 15 trips, depending upon its building and construction High Quality Wooden Pallets and the care it gets during usage.
Q3: What is heat treatment worrying wooden pallets?
A3: Heat treatment is a process that involves heating the pallets to a specific temperature level to kill off pests and pathogens, making them safe for worldwide shipping according to ISPM 15 policies.
Q4: Can wooden pallets be recycled?
A4: Yes, Wooden Pallets For Shipping pallets can be easily recycled into mulch or re-manufactured into new pallets or wood-based products, adding to a circular economy.
Q5: What are the alternatives to wooden pallets?
A5: Alternatives consist of plastic and metal pallets. While they do use specific advantages such as boosted tidiness and longevity, they typically feature greater expenses and ecological considerations.
